		<description>[...] A columbarium however tends to ruin surrounding property values. In addition to cultural concerns about ghosts and spirits, columbarians can attract huge crowds of ancestor worshippers, particularly during  festivals such as Ching Ming and Ching Yeung, along with the associated disruption, inconvenience, littering and fires from worshippers burning traditional paper offerings.
